Antonov An-225 at Kyiv-Hostomel, Ukraine, destroyed during military attack while parked on ground

Unconfirmed reports are coming from Kyiv Hostomel airport, home base of Antonov Airlines, that the only Antonov An-225 with registration UR-82060ever built, is possibly on fire and/or damaged after the airport has been under siege from russian attack forces for days.

Recent pictures by Maxar reveals that the free standing structure usually covering the An-225 is indeed damaged and smoke is seen rising.

 

Update March 3rd, 2022

Videos have started floating on Twitter showing extensive damage to the fuselage of the An-225. The nose of the aircraft is seen resting directly on ground.

 

Update March 4th, 2022

Images released by Russian State TV show clear damage to the front section of the right hand wing and fuselage of the An-225. Rear section still status is still unknown but the aircraft looks like a total loss at this time. The state of an unfinished An-225 airframe is not known at this time.

Update April 4h 2022

New footage from Hostomel Airport shows the extensive damage of the An-225. The airport has been taken back by Ukraine forces.
